Excerpt from Austria and the Austrians, Vol. 2 of 2

Tms extraordinary personage is one of those statesmen whose character and talents are scarcely known in Europe, however much his name has been before the public, and much as he has been personally associated with many of the most important events of the age.

I have had the opportunity to judge of him in his own country, and in his own person. I may speak of him Without bias, although I differ from him in my ideas of governing na tions, and although I consider the only sound political principles to be those of civil liberty.
